“When Rhea and Eddie’s Chevy breaks down in the middle of nowhere, they’re forced to seek refuge in St. Andrew, the kind of town people drive through every day without stopping. There’s just something off about the place.
With grief and guilt at her heels, Rhea works for their room at the town’s only bar. Everything and everyone there reminds her of her family. But for the first time in three years, she is also shown kindness. Would these new “friends” see her the same if they knew the drugs she had carried killed her little sister?
Meanwhile, St. Andrew’s estranged priest offers Eddie salvation from his past. But Eddie doesn’t need saving, not when he’s got Rhea and the comfort in the bottom of a bottle. Still, the dark figure seen out of the corner of Eddie’s eye since crossing town lines promises much more. Will Eddie give into temptation?
What was supposed to be a temporary stay turns into a struggle against darkness and damnation. Will these two young lovers reconcile their guilty past of drugs and death or be trapped in this haunted Midwestern town forever?”
Chuck Lang is a sci-fi horror author whose works uncover malevolent forces and feature raw characters grappling with dark pasts. His recent release, DEAD GODS from the SINS OF SAINT ANDREW series, is an intense supernatural horror set in a haunted Midwestern town where the damned walk with the living. Experience the psychological torment of Saint Andrew in a novel New York Times bestselling author, Kevin J. Anderson, describes as “dark, creepy, relentless.”
Chuck has an MFA from Lindenwood University and has taught creative writing and literature for two decades after stints as a carpenter and a sailor in the US Navy. Chuck lives and writes near the frequently flooded Red River in Fargo, ND with his incredible family and two cats who love destroying his house plants.
